X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/a086de984d366b97e91b39aaba7acd84430d963a..be88a6ade981b99d55fa1da20cd1a12be4a075f2:/include/wx/os2/window.h diff --git a/include/wx/os2/window.h b/include/wx/os2/window.h index 318f7c5801..12e1debc20 100644 --- a/include/wx/os2/window.h +++ b/include/wx/os2/window.h @@ -95,6 +95,7 @@ public: virtual bool Show(bool bShow = TRUE); virtual bool Enable(bool bEnable = TRUE); virtual void SetFocus(void); + virtual void SetFocusFromKbd(void); virtual bool Reparent(wxWindow* pNewParent); virtual void WarpPointer( int x ,int y @@ -271,6 +272,9 @@ public: { return OS2GetStyle(GetWindowStyle(), pdwExflags); } + // get the HWND to be used as parent of this window with CreateWindow() + virtual WXHWND OS2GetParent(void) const; + // returns TRUE if the window has been created bool OS2Create( PSZ zClass ,const char* zTitle @@ -390,8 +394,12 @@ public: bool HandleSysCommand( WXWPARAM wParam ,WXLPARAM lParam ); - bool HandlePaletteChanged(); + bool HandlePaletteChanged(void); + bool HandleQueryNewPalette(void); bool HandleSysColorChange(void); + bool HandleDisplayChange(void); + bool HandleCaptureChanged(WXHWND hBainedCapture); + bool HandleCtlColor(WXHBRUSH* hBrush); bool HandleSetFocus(WXHWND hWnd); bool HandleKillFocus(WXHWND hWnd); @@ -405,7 +413,7 @@ public: ,int nY ,WXUINT uFlags ); - bool HandleChar( WXDWORD wParam + bool HandleChar( WXWPARAM wParam ,WXLPARAM lParam ,bool bIsASCII = FALSE );